Output d24dc3c86cb15206d59a6b52e90587183c1fc800008ee0986dc3f59e80ef4dff:93

value
34169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0409b030e8a78628a0a3469a6bc5c0c27e661c9e OP_EQUAL
address
324NETmC3MkjSKh868DyxzFpuaPnGZQWHf
transaction
d24dc3c86cb15206d59a6b52e90587183c1fc800008ee0986dc3f59e80ef4dff
spent
true